What are the different types of underground hard rock drilling machines?
Within underground hard rock drilling, various machines serve distinct purposes. Two predominant types, the jumbo drill and the long-hole drill, spearhead these operations. 1. Jumbo Drill: A powerhouse designed explicitly for drilling blast holes in underground hard rock.

Who invented the Rock Drill?
In 1849, J. J. Couch, an American inventor from Philadelphia, received the first patent for a rock drill. It featured a drill rod which passed through a hollow piston and was thrown against the rock. In 1851, James Fowle received a patent for a rock drill powered by steam or compressed air.
